Effects of Myokinetic Stretching Technique and Post Facilitation Stretching on Pain, Range of Motion, and Functional Disability in Patients With Cervical Radicular Pain
NCT07724470 · Status: RECRUITING · Phase: NA · Type: INTERVENTIONAL · Enrollment: 40
Last updated 2026-07-24
Summary
Cervical radicular pain (CRP) is a musculoskeletal condition characterized by neck pain radiating to the upper limb due to compression or irritation of cervical nerve roots. It significantly affects daily activities, cervical mobility, and overall quality of life. Conventional physical therapy focuses on reducing pain and improving function; however, there is limited evidence comparing the effectiveness of different stretching techniques used in clinical practice.
This randomized controlled trial aims to compare the effectiveness of Myokinetic Stretching Technique (MST) and Post Facilitation Stretching (PFS) on pain intensity, cervical range of motion, and functional disability in patients with cervical radicular pain.
A total of 70 participants with cervical radicular pain (\>4 weeks) will be randomly allocated into two groups:
Group A (Myokinetic Stretching Technique Group) - receiving MST along with conventional therapy including hot pack application, cervical isometric exercises, neurodynamic gliding, and continuous cervical traction.
Group B (Post Facilitation Stretching Group) - receiving Post Facilitation Stretching along with the same conventional therapy.
The intervention will be conducted for 4 weeks, with 3 sessions per week on alternate days, each session lasting approximately 45 minutes.
Outcome measures will include:
Pain intensity assessed using the Visual Analogue Scale (VAS) Cervical range of motion measured using a goniometer Functional disability assessed using the Neck Disability Index (NDI)
This study aims to determine the more effective stretching technique for reducing pain, improving cervical mobility, and enhancing functional outcomes, thereby supporting evidence-based physiotherapy practice in managing cervical radicular pain.

Myokinetic Stretching Technique
Participants in this group will receive Myokinetic Stretching Technique (MST) along with conventional physiotherapy treatment. The program will be delivered for 4 weeks, with 3 sessions per week on alternate days, each session lasting approximately 45 minutes. Conventional treatment will include hot pack application to the cervical region, cervical isometric exercises (flexion, extension, lateral flexion, and rotation), neurodynamic gliding techniques, and continuous cervical traction. MST will be applied to the cervical musculature, particularly the trapezius muscle. The participant will be positioned in supine, and the therapist will perform controlled lateral flexion stretching followed by myofascial release using sustained pressure (5-10 seconds). The technique will be performed in sets with brief rest intervals to improve muscle flexibility and reduce pain.

Post facilitation stretching
Participants in this group will receive Post Facilitation Stretching (PFS) along with conventional physiotherapy treatment. The program will be conducted for 4 weeks, with 3 sessions per week on alternate days, each session lasting approximately 45 minutes. Conventional treatment will include hot pack application to the cervical region, cervical isometric exercises (flexion, extension, lateral flexion, and rotation), neurodynamic gliding techniques, and continuous cervical traction. PFS will be applied to the cervical musculature, particularly the trapezius muscle. The participant will be positioned in supine, and the therapist will guide the muscle into a neutral position followed by a strong voluntary contraction for approximately 10 seconds. After relaxation, a rapid passive stretch will be applied and held briefly. The procedure will be repeated in sets with short rest intervals to improve muscle extensibility and reduce pain.
